The operation of stretch wrapping machines is relatively straightforward, but beginners should still master some basic steps and precautions to ensure proper equipment function and safe operation. Below is a comprehensive guide for new users:
I. Basic Operating Steps for Stretch Wrapping Machines
1. Pre-Operation Preparation
- Inspect Equipment: Verify power connections are secure, check all components for damage or loose parts, and clear debris around the machine.
- Install stretch film: Properly load the stretch film onto the machine, paying attention to the installation direction (usually indicated by arrows).
- Position goods: Place items to be wrapped steadily on the turntable or conveyor belt, ensuring they are secure.
2. Start the Equipment
- Set parameters: Adjust parameters such as wrap cycles, speed, and tension based on the goods' dimensions and packaging requirements.
- Begin operation: Press the start button to initiate automatic operation. The turntable or conveyor belt rotates the goods while the stretch film is automatically dispensed and wrapped around them.
3. Monitor operation
- Observe equipment status: Ensure the stretch film dispenses normally and the goods remain stable during packaging.
- Replace stretch film promptly: When the roll is nearly depleted, press the pause button to replace it with a new roll, then resume operation.
4. Ending Operation
- Shut down equipment: After packaging is complete, press the stop button, turn off the power, and clean the equipment and work area.
- Daily maintenance: Clean the equipment, inspect all components for proper function, and apply lubricant as needed.
II. Precautions for New Users
1. Safe Operation
- Wear protective gear: Wear gloves, safety helmets, and other protective equipment during operation to avoid contact with moving parts.
- Maintain Safe Distance: Keep personnel away from the turntable and wrapping area during operation to prevent accidents.
2. Equipment Maintenance
- Regular Cleaning: Daily wipe down of equipment surfaces and internal components to prevent dust and debris from affecting performance.
- Lubrication Maintenance: Periodically apply lubricant to transmission parts to ensure smooth operation.
3. Troubleshooting Common Issues
- Film Breakage: Verify proper film installation, adjust tension, or replace the roll.
- Abnormal Noise: Immediately shut down the machine for inspection. Tighten loose components or contact maintenance personnel.
